Bug ID: 429457 Summary: Cannot set proxy server with IPv6 address Product: systemsettings Version: 5.19.5 Platform: Debian testing OS: Linux Status: REPORTED Severity: major Priority: NOR Component: kcm_networkmanagement Assignee: jgrul...@redhat.com Reporter: trevorpear...@gmail.com CC: plasma-b...@kde.org Target Milestone: --- SUMMARY When setting a manual proxy socks proxy server with an IPv6 address, the address is ignored STEPS TO REPRODUCE 1. Open system settings 2. Open network settings 3. Set a valid SOCKS proxy with an IPv6 address 4. Apply and close system settings 5. Open system settings 6. Open network settings 7. SOCKS proxy field is blank and port is reset to 0 OBSERVED RESULT After closing and repopening system setting and entering network settings, the proxy field and port have been reset to blank and 0, respectively EXPECTED RESULT Should be able to access a SOCKS proxy with IPv6 S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S Windows: macOS: Linux/KDE Plasma: 5.19.5 (available in About System) KDE Plasma Version: 5.19.5 KDE Frameworks Version: 5.74.0 Qt Version: 5.15.1 ADDITIONAL INFORMATION -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.
